Ella Langley’s Rise Sends Shockwaves Through the Country Music Industry

Ella Langley is making waves across the music world as her latest success continues to fuel a growing conversation about the direction of modern country music.

Her breakout momentum has placed her firmly at the top of the charts with multiple No. 1 achievements, sparking intense debate among fans and industry watchers about the balance between traditional country roots and contemporary pop-influenced sounds.

With massive streaming numbers and sustained chart dominance, Langley’s rise has become one of the most talked-about stories in Nashville right now. Supporters say her success reflects a return to authentic storytelling, steel-guitar-driven production, and classic country energy that has long defined the genre.

At the center of the conversation is how quickly she has climbed, turning early buzz into full-scale mainstream recognition. Her collaborations and songwriting partnerships—including work with Miranda Lambert—have further strengthened her reputation as one of country music’s most promising new voices.

The surge in attention has also reignited the ongoing discussion between country traditionalists and pop-country crossover artists. Rather than a simple shift, many see it as a clash of styles that is reshaping the modern Nashville landscape in real time.

While comparisons across eras and genres continue to circulate online, Langley’s supporters argue that her success isn’t about replacing anyone—it’s about expanding space for a new wave of country artists to thrive.

As her momentum builds, one thing is clear: Ella Langley is no longer just a rising star—she’s becoming a defining voice in the next chapter of country music.
